by Frankenstein » Wed Jul 06, 2011 6:13 am
Hi,
As you have eliminated 3 choices in each question, I will explain the remaining two choices.
1. A recent study has found that within the past few years, many doctors had elected
early retirement rather than face
the threats of lawsuits and the rising costs of
malpractice insurance.
(A) had elected early retirement rather than face
(B) had elected early retirement instead of facing
(C) have elected retiring early instead of facing
(D) have elected to retire early rather than facing
(E) have elected to retire early rather than face...
Look for parallelism:
E is nothing but have elected to retire early rather than (to) face
B lacks parallelism retirement vs facing
Hence, E

2)A recent study of ancient clay deposits has provided new evidence supporting the
theory of global forest fires ignited by a meteorite impact that
contributed to the
extinction of the dinosaurs and many other creatures some 65 million years ago.
(A) supporting the theory of global forest fires ignited by a meteorite impact that
(B) supporting the theory that global forest fires ignited by a meteorite impact
(C) that supports the theory of global forest fires that were ignited by a meteorite
impact and that
(D) in support of the theory that global forest fires were ignited by a meteorite
impact and that
(E) of support for the theory of a meteorite impact that ignited global forest fires
and
D states: the theory that global forest fires were ignited by a meteorite impact,
the theory that contributed to the extinction of the dinosaurs and many other creatures some 65 million years ago.
the second part means the theory itself contributed to the extinction of dinosaurs.

Hence, B
